Ken Watanabe cheers on Samurai Blue

13 Comments

Actor Ken Watanabe, 50, gave a supporting cheer for the Samurai Blue national World Cup team at a press conference for NTT Docomo this week. "Make it into the Top 4, aim to win. Take onto the field with you courage and resolution, and remember that your country is depending on you," the actor said.

Docomo's new campaign commercial features Watanabe and singer-songwriter Kaela Kimura, 25, as two Docomo mobile phones, along with Masaki Okada, 20, and Maki Horikita, 21, in human roles. Watanabe joked, "I'd like to continue making more commercials from here on out, so if I could just trade numbers with Kaela."
